Meaning
Self-balancing scooters are battery-powered, two-wheeled personal transportation devices designed to maintain balance and stability while in use. They utilize gyroscopic sensors, accelerometers, and other advanced technologies to detect the rider’s movements and adjust accordingly, allowing for smooth and intuitive control. These scooters are typically compact, lightweight, and portable, making them ideal for urban commuting and recreational purposes.

Market Restraints
- Safety concerns: Despite advancements in safety features, accidents and injuries related to self-balancing scooters have been reported. Issues such as faulty batteries, inadequate training, and lack of adherence to safety guidelines can pose risks to riders. Manufacturers and regulatory bodies need to address these concerns and ensure the safety of users.
- Legal and regulatory challenges: The use of self-balancing scooters is subject to regulations and restrictions in many regions. Some areas prohibit their use on public roads or sidewalks, limiting the potential market size. It is essential for manufacturers to collaborate with authorities to establish clear guidelines and regulations to facilitate the widespread adoption of self-balancing scooters.
- Limited battery life and charging infrastructure: The range and battery life of self-balancing scooters are still relatively limited compared to other electric vehicles. Users may face range anxiety and the need for frequent recharging, especially during long commutes. The availability of charging infrastructure also plays a crucial role in the adoption of self-balancing scooters, and the lack thereof may hinder market growth.

Market Key Trends
- Integration of advanced safety features: Manufacturers are incorporating advanced safety features such as intelligent braking systems, LED lighting, and anti-slip foot pads to enhance rider safety. These features provide improved stability and control, reducing the risk of accidents and injuries.
- Smart connectivity and IoT integration: Self-balancing scooters are being equipped with smart features and connectivity options. Integration with smartphone applications allows users to monitor battery life, track distance traveled, and customize riding preferences. This trend enhances the overall user experience and opens up possibilities for future advancements.
- Lightweight and foldable designs: Manufacturers are focusing on developing lightweight and foldable designs to enhance portability and convenience. Foldable self-balancing scooters can be easily carried and stored, making them ideal for urban commuters and travelers.
- Sustainable materials and manufacturing processes: There is a growing emphasis on sustainable materials and manufacturing processes in the production of self-balancing scooters. Manufacturers are utilizing recycled materials, reducing waste, and implementing eco-friendly manufacturing practices to align with the increasing environmental concerns.
Covid-19 Impact
The COVID-19 pandemic had both positive and negative impacts on the self-balancing scooter market. Initially, the market faced challenges due to disruptions in the global supply chain and reduced consumer spending. However, as lockdowns eased and people sought alternative transportation options, the demand for self-balancing scooters increased. The pandemic highlighted the need for personal mobility and the benefits of individual transportation. As a result, self-balancing scooters gained popularity as a safe and efficient mode of commuting.
